One County. Very Different Electrical Installations.

Loudoun County contains a wide range of residential properties. Eastern Loudoun includes dense townhome communities, newer subdivisions and highly finished homes, while western Loudoun includes larger lots, older properties, detached garages and longer outdoor electrical routes.

That variety affects EV charger installation. A charger beside a garage panel can be relatively direct, while another project may require a dedicated circuit from a finished basement, through multiple framing transitions, outdoors or to a detached structure.

Before recommending an installation, we evaluate:

  • electrical service capacity
  • existing household demand
  • panel and breaker space
  • charger specifications
  • requested charging output
  • panel-to-charger distance
  • vehicle parking position
  • charge-port location and cable reach
  • finished walls and ceilings
  • outdoor or detached-structure routing when applicable

03 / electrical capacity

Your Main Breaker Doesn't Tell the Whole Story

A 200-amp electrical service or open breaker spaces do not automatically establish that enough capacity is available for a high-output EV charging circuit. Existing household electrical demand must also be considered.

A hardwired charger operating continuously at 48 amps requires an appropriately designed dedicated circuit. Before recommending that charging output, Auto Charge Pros evaluates the home's electrical system and completes the appropriate capacity calculation when needed.

If capacity is limited, the solution is not automatically a service upgrade.

REDUCED CHARGING OUTPUT

Many Level 2 chargers can be configured for a lower circuit rating while still providing useful overnight charging.

LOAD MANAGEMENT

Compatible listed load-management equipment can allow charging to operate within available electrical capacity when appropriate.

POWER SHARING

Compatible chargers can sometimes share available charging capacity when multiple EVs need to charge at the same property.

ELECTRICAL UPGRADES

Panel, feeder or service improvements are evaluated when the existing system genuinely requires them.

05 / eastern vs. western loudoun

EV Charging Across Very Different Parts of Loudoun

The county-wide plan starts with the actual property, electrical equipment and parking pattern.

EASTERN LOUDOUN

Ashburn, Broadlands and Brambleton contain many townhomes, newer single-family homes and highly finished interiors. Basement-to-garage routing, drywall access and charger placement can become major parts of the installation plan.

DULLES SOUTH

Aldie, South Riding, Stone Ridge and nearby communities contain a mix of townhomes and larger single-family homes. Panel location, finished basements, parking layout and association requirements can affect the route.

LEESBURG & CENTRAL LOUDOUN

Leesburg includes newer development as well as established and historic properties. Wiring routes, existing electrical equipment and Town-specific requirements may require additional property-level planning.

WESTERN LOUDOUN

Purcellville, Hamilton, Middleburg and surrounding areas include larger lots, older homes, rural properties and detached structures. Longer exterior or underground routes may require different wiring methods and planning.

06 / wiring & workmanship

Concealed Wiring, Outdoor Routes and Detached Garages

The charger mounted on the wall is only the visible portion of the installation. The wiring route between the electrical panel and charging location is equally important.

When practical, Auto Charge Pros prefers concealed wiring through accessible framing, unfinished areas, basements, ceilings or attics instead of automatically running exposed conduit across finished spaces.

If drywall access is required, expected openings are discussed before installation whenever practical. Where included in the written estimate, removed drywall can be fastened back after the required electrical work and inspection. Full finishing—including tape, compound and sanding—is available separately when requested.

For detached garages, outdoor parking areas and longer property routes, we evaluate appropriate wiring methods, weather exposure, physical protection and underground routing when applicable.

07 / permits & inspections

Loudoun County EV Charger Permits & Inspections

Permit and inspection requirements vary by jurisdiction and project scope. Auto Charge Pros confirms the applicable process for the actual property and work being performed.

Loudoun County currently processes online permit applications and inspection scheduling through LandMARC. The inspection sequence and property-access requirements depend on the individual project and approved scope.

Before installation, we explain the expected permit process, wiring route, inspection access and any portions of the electrical work that may need to remain visible until inspection.

Private HOA or property-owner association requirements are separate from County permitting. Properties within incorporated towns may also have separate local zoning, architectural or historic requirements depending on the property and scope.

Technical note: Loudoun County currently enforces the 2021 Virginia Uniform Statewide Building Code and 2020 National Electrical Code.

09 / cost

What Affects EV Charger Installation Cost in Loudoun County?

The largest cost differences usually come from the electrical system and wiring route rather than the charger mounted on the wall.

Installation cost can be affected by:

  • panel location
  • available service capacity
  • circuit length
  • finished basement or drywall access
  • charger output
  • indoor vs. outdoor location
  • conduit or underground routing
  • detached structures
  • load-management equipment
  • permitting
  • electrical corrections
  • drywall restoration

A short garage-panel installation can be very different from a concealed basement-to-garage route or a circuit serving a detached structure.

11 / questions homeowners ask

Loudoun County EV Charger Installation FAQs

01

How much does installation cost?

Cost depends primarily on electrical capacity, circuit distance, wiring route, charger location, permitting, load management and restoration. We review the setup before providing a written estimate.

02

Do I need a permit?

Permit and inspection requirements vary by jurisdiction and project scope. Auto Charge Pros confirms the applicable process for the actual property and work being performed.

03

Can my home support a 48-amp charger?

Possibly. Available capacity depends on existing electrical demand, not only the main-breaker rating or available panel spaces.

04

Do I need a 200-amp service?

Not necessarily. The appropriate charging output depends on actual available capacity. Reduced charging output or compatible load management may be practical alternatives.

05

Do I need a panel upgrade?

Not automatically. We recommend a panel, feeder or service upgrade only when the existing electrical system actually requires it.

06

Can you install from a basement panel?

Yes. Basement-to-garage installations are common. The actual route depends on framing, finished areas, accessible spaces and garage location.

07

Can you install a charger in a detached garage?

Potentially. We evaluate the existing feeder or service, distance, route, wiring method and available capacity before recommending an installation.
